Q1 Planning Note — Sales Leads, Brenholt Software

Status: Project Lanyard slips again. New target is end of Q2. CRM migration and quoting tools stay on the legacy stack until then. Do not promise Lanyard features to prospects. Workarounds: manual quote approvals via regional ops, weekly pipeline exports from Corbin's team. Escalations go to Mireille. Hiring for the integration squad continues; two roles filled, one open. Planning implications for the year are set out below.

board note of fafog-yahap: Project Rusdor slips by a full year because of the audit delay.

**Postmortem timeline — Ledgerwell tax-rate cache incident**

14:22 — On-call paged after checkout errors spiked in the Ostermark region. 14:31 — Confirmed the tax-rate lookup cache in the Ledgerwell pricing service was serving stale entries after the midnight rate import silently failed. 14:47 — Cache flushed manually; error rate recovered within four minutes. For correlation with the import job logs, the trace reference from the failed run is recorded below.

build token for kagaf-hahof: htk14_9d3d4d26d7d8de

## Onboarding: Dark Mode in the Corvid Admin Dashboard

Dark mode in Corvid is theme-token driven — never hardcode hex values. All colors resolve through the `corvid-tokens` package, and the toggle persists per user in workspace settings. When adding components, test both themes plus the high-contrast variant, and attach screenshots to your PR. Known gap: embedded charts ignore the theme until refresh. Questions for this week's sync should be sent ahead of time.

billing contact of yawip-yadup = druath.casdor@nelvrolabs.internal